    The Congressional Black Caucus passed a vote of no confidence in Democratic National Committee Chair Tom Perez on Wednesday after a "heated" debate over the superdelegate policy. Back in August, the DNC leadership decided to strip superdelegates of authority. Under new rules, superdelegates are not permitted to vote on the first presidential nominating ballot at a contested national convention. The move was intended to placate progressives who believe the superdelegates had too much power over the election process.


    But, CBC Chairman Cedric Richmond (D-LA) spoke for many in his caucus when he accused the DNC of "pitting them against their constituents."


    “So now if they want to be a delegate, they have to run against their constituents who want to be delegates, and it’s an unfair proposition,” Richmond said in a POLITICO interview this week. “We don’t want to run against our constituents, so the caucus had made its position known.”.....snip~
